KEVIN AND THE ANORAKS
Short-lived combo comprising Ray Russell (ex-Trug Concept ) and former Chainsaw
Surgeon , Steve Dann.
Ray recalls:
Ray Russell is proprietor of Tartarus Press, publishers of the weird and wonderful.
"We played
the Zap Club in Brighton twice, following a chap called Captain Stupid, and on another
occasion a woman who breast-fed her baby. The only songs we did I remember are
"We're All Going up the May" (presumably a reference to the group's
local, 'The May Garland' in Horam - Ed) and "Planet Zanussi".
We were hardly a pivotal band in the white-hot ferment of the Wealden music scene!"
